    EXAMPLES OF DUTIES:
    (List does not include all duties assigned)


    • Escorts patients to exam rooms and prepares patients for examinations and procedures according to physician preferences.
    • Records vital signs of patients, including pulse, blood pressure, height, etc.
    • Performs appropriate procedures, such as phlebotomy, injections, EKGs, holter monitors, etc.
    • Assists the physician(s) with procedures, as well as administering medications and conducting patient educations.
    • Handles phone nursing when appropriate, to include triaging, pre-certs, referrals, calling in prescriptions, etc.
    • Performs clerical duties necessary for the physicians to see patients; contacts patients regarding test results or for other related reasons as directed.
    • If needed, schedules patient appointments with efficient use of clinical time slots.
    • Maintains stocked, neat and clean exam rooms and common work areas on a daily basis.
